Promoting health in Zambian communities
Habitat’s definition of decent housing includes access to clean water, something more than 40% of Zambians don’t have. By partnering with Habitat Zambia, many communities can now access clean, treated water.

Bank of America, Habitat for Humanity kick off sixth Global Build in 108 communities
Largest initiative to date will mobilize nearly 2,800 bank volunteers across 10 countries to help address the need for affordable housing.
